What is a direct mail print production manager?

A Direct Mail Print Production Manager oversees the planning, coordination, and execution of print materials for direct mail campaigns. They work closely with marketing teams, vendors, and printers to ensure that mail pieces are produced on time, within budget, and to quality standards. Responsibilities often include managing schedules, selecting materials, negotiating costs, and ensuring compliance with postal regulations. Their role is essential in ensuring that direct mail campaigns are effective and reach the intended audience.

What are some common challenges faced by direct mail print production managers when coordinating large-scale campaigns?

Direct Mail Print Production Managers often navigate tight deadlines, complex logistics, and the need to coordinate multiple vendors to ensure timely and accurate campaign delivery. Managing quality control across different print providers and balancing cost-efficiency with high production standards can also present challenges. Additionally, they must stay updated on postal regulations and work closely with marketing, design, and data teams to ensure each campaign meets strategic goals and compliance requirements.

What is the difference between Direct Mail Print Production Manager vs Print Production Coordinator?

AspectDirect Mail Print Production ManagerPrint Production Coordinator
CredentialsExperience in print management, industry certifications often preferredRelevant experience, sometimes certifications, but generally less specialized
Work EnvironmentOffice setting with collaboration with marketing and print vendorsOffice and production environment, coordinating with vendors and internal teams
Industry UsageCommonly used in direct mail and marketing industriesUsed across various print production settings, including marketing and publishing

The Direct Mail Print Production Manager focuses on overseeing the entire direct mail printing process, ensuring quality and timely delivery, often requiring industry-specific certifications. The Print Production Coordinator handles day-to-day coordination of print jobs, managing schedules and vendor communication. While both roles require print industry knowledge, the manager role is more strategic and supervisory, whereas the coordinator role is more operational and task-focused.
